The BICSI RTPM exam has 100 questions in 2 hours with a scaled passing score. Major domains: Project Planning (25%), Schedule/Resource Management (20%), Cost/Procurement (15%), Execution/Quality (15%), Risk/Safety (15%), Communications/Closeout (10%). Requires ICT PM experience.

1What is the PRIMARY role of a BICSI Registered Telecommunications Project Manager (RTPM)?
A.Installing cabling systems in commercial buildings
B.Overseeing and coordinating the interaction between designers, engineers, installers, and technicians on ICT projects
C.Designing network architectures for data centers
D.Selling telecommunications equipment to enterprise clients
Explanation: The RTPM oversees and coordinates the interaction between designers, engineers, installers, and technicians when new ICT projects are being developed or undergoing construction. The role focuses on project management rather than hands-on installation, design, or sales. Exam Tip: Understand that the RTPM is a management credential focused on coordinating ICT project stakeholders through the full project lifecycle.
2According to BICSI, a project is BEST defined as which of the following?
A.An ongoing operational activity with no defined end date
B.A temporary endeavor with a definite beginning and end that delivers a product or service
C.A recurring maintenance schedule for telecommunications infrastructure
D.A permanent organizational function responsible for network upkeep
Explanation: BICSI defines a project as a temporary endeavor that has a definite beginning and end, whose end result is the delivery of a product or service. Projects are distinguished from ongoing operations by their temporary nature and unique deliverables. Exam Tip: Remember that projects are governed by constraints including scope, time, cost, and quality.
3Which of the following is the FIRST phase in the ICT project lifecycle?
A.Project execution
B.Project planning
C.Project initiation
D.Project closeout
Explanation: Project initiation is the first phase of the ICT project lifecycle. During initiation, the project manager identifies the project scope, stakeholders, objectives, and constraints. This phase establishes the foundation upon which all subsequent phases are built. Exam Tip: Know the correct sequence of project lifecycle phases: initiation, planning, execution, monitoring and controlling, and closeout.
4During project initiation, which activity is MOST critical for an ICT project manager?
A.Ordering materials and equipment
B.Verifying customer requirements and specifications
C.Creating a detailed work breakdown structure
D.Conducting final acceptance testing
Explanation: During project initiation, verifying customer requirements and specifications is the most critical activity. This ensures the project team understands what must be delivered and establishes clear expectations. Ordering materials occurs during execution, WBS creation is a planning activity, and acceptance testing occurs during closeout. Exam Tip: Project initiation focuses on defining the 'what' and 'why' before the 'how' is addressed in planning.
5What is the triple constraint in project management?
A.People, process, and technology
B.Scope, time, and cost
C.Design, installation, and testing
D.Planning, execution, and closeout
Explanation: The triple constraint (also called the iron triangle) consists of scope, time, and cost. These three elements are interdependent, meaning a change to one typically affects the others. Quality is often considered the fourth constraint at the center of the triangle. Exam Tip: When answering questions about trade-offs, always consider how changes to one constraint affect the other two.
6Which document formally authorizes the existence of a project and gives the project manager authority to apply organizational resources?
A.Work breakdown structure
B.Project charter
C.Statement of work
D.Request for proposal
Explanation: The project charter formally authorizes the project and provides the project manager with the authority to apply organizational resources to project activities. It includes high-level objectives, constraints, assumptions, and stakeholder identification. Exam Tip: The project charter is created during the initiation phase and is one of the most important documents for establishing project authority.
7A telecommunications project manager discovers that the customer's building has asbestos-containing materials in the ceiling plenum where cables must be routed. What should be the FIRST course of action?
A.Proceed with installation and notify the customer afterward
B.Stop work in the affected area and consult with the customer about abatement requirements
C.Remove the asbestos independently to avoid project delays
D.Reroute all cables through exterior pathways without consulting the customer
Explanation: When asbestos-containing materials are discovered, the project manager must immediately stop work in the affected area and consult with the customer about professional abatement. Asbestos handling requires licensed specialists and compliance with federal, state, and local regulations. Proceeding without proper abatement or attempting removal without certification poses serious health and legal risks. Exam Tip: Safety hazards always take priority and require immediate action followed by stakeholder notification.
8What is the PRIMARY purpose of a site survey in an ICT project?
A.To negotiate the contract price with the customer
B.To observe and document a project's existing conditions
C.To train the installation crew on safety procedures
D.To test the performance of installed cabling
Explanation: A site survey enables ICT design personnel to observe and document a project's existing conditions. This includes evaluating the physical environment, existing infrastructure, pathway availability, power systems, and any conditions that may affect design and installation. Exam Tip: Site surveys should occur early in the project to identify conditions that could impact scope, cost, or schedule before detailed planning begins.
9During a site survey, the project manager identifies that the existing cable tray is at 40% fill capacity. According to BICSI standards, what is the MAXIMUM recommended fill capacity for cable trays?
A.25%
B.40%
C.50%
D.75%
Explanation: BICSI standards recommend a maximum fill capacity of 50% for cable trays to allow for future growth, proper cable management, and adequate airflow. At 40%, the tray has room for additional cables but is approaching the recommended limit. Exceeding fill capacity can lead to cable damage, heat buildup, and difficulty in managing future installations. Exam Tip: Always account for fill ratios and future growth when evaluating pathway capacity during site surveys.
10Which of the following items should be documented during a site survey for an ICT project?
A.Only the locations of telecommunications rooms
B.Only the electrical panel locations
C.Existing infrastructure, pathway availability, environmental conditions, and access restrictions
D.Only the number of workstations needed
Explanation: A comprehensive site survey documents existing infrastructure, pathway availability, environmental conditions, access restrictions, ceiling types, floor types, power availability, and any conditions that could affect the project. Documenting only one element provides an incomplete picture that could lead to costly surprises during installation. Exam Tip: Use a standardized site survey checklist to ensure all critical elements are evaluated and documented.

BICSI RTPM Exam Content Outline

25%

Project Planning and Initiation

Scope definition, project charter, stakeholder identification, technology assessment

20%

Schedule and Resource Management

Work breakdown structure, critical path, resource allocation, milestone tracking

15%

Cost Management and Procurement

Budgeting, cost estimation, vendor selection, contract management, change orders

15%

Execution and Quality Management

Construction oversight, quality assurance, inspections, code compliance

15%

Risk Management and Safety

Risk identification, mitigation strategies, safety planning, OSHA compliance

10%

Communications and Closeout

Stakeholder communication, reporting, documentation, lessons learned, handoff

Frequently Asked Questions

What is the BICSI RTPM exam?

The BICSI RTPM is the leading certification for ICT project managers. It has 100 questions in 2 hours covering project planning, scheduling, cost control, quality management, and risk management. A scaled passing score determined by a standard-setting study is required.

What are the BICSI RTPM eligibility requirements?

You need a combination of telecommunications project management education, training, and verifiable field experience. Multiple eligibility pathways exist. Your application must be approved by BICSI before scheduling the exam.

How hard is the BICSI RTPM exam?

The RTPM is moderately challenging with a 60-70% estimated first-time pass rate. It requires knowledge of both project management principles and ICT-specific construction practices. Most candidates study 100-150 hours over 8-12 weeks.

How is the RTPM different from PMP certification?

The RTPM focuses specifically on telecommunications and ICT infrastructure project management, including technology-specific construction oversight and code compliance. PMP is a general project management certification. RTPM holders have specialized ICT project expertise.

How often must I renew RTPM certification?

RTPM certification must be renewed every 3 years. Renewal requires 36 approved continuing education credits (CECs) from BICSI-approved providers during each certification cycle.

What types of projects do RTPMs manage?

RTPMs manage ICT infrastructure projects including structured cabling installations, data center builds, outside plant construction, wireless deployments, and building technology upgrades. They coordinate between designers, engineers, installers, and technicians.

Can I take the RTPM exam online?

Yes, the RTPM exam is available both at Pearson VUE test centers and via online proctoring. Online testing requires a stable internet connection, webcam, and a quiet, private workspace that meets Pearson VUE requirements.
